Classic Motor City Sugar Cookies

Classic Motor City Sugar Cookies are a beloved holiday treat that embodies the spirit of Detroit’s festive celebrations. These cookies are soft, buttery, and perfect for decorating, making them ideal for family gatherings or cookie exchanges. Once baked, they can be dressed up with colorful icing, sprinkles, or even holiday-themed designs, making them not only delicious but also visually appealing.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 3 cups |
| Baking powder | 1 teaspoon |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ter | 1 cup (softened) |
| Granulated sugar | 1 ½ cups |
| Egg |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 2 teaspoons |
| Almond extract | 1 teaspoon (optional) |
| Powdered sugar | For icing |
| Milk | For icing |
| Food coloring | (optional) |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t until well combined. Set a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ugar: In a large mixing bowl, use a hand mixer or stand mixer to cream the softened butter and granulated sugar together. Mix on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Egg and Extracts: Beat in the egg, vanilla extract, and almond extract (if using) until the mixture is smooth and well incorporated.
- Combine Mixtures: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et ingredients. Start mixing on low speed to prevent flour from flying out, then increase to medium speed until combined. Do not overmix.
- Chill the Dough: For best results, cover the dough with plastic wrap and refrigerate for about 30 minutes. This helps the cookies maintain their shape while baking.
- Prepare for Baking: Once chilled, remove the dough from the refrigerator. Scoop tablespoon-sized balls of dough and place them on the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
- Flatten and Bake: Gently flatten each dough ball with the bottom of a glass or your palm. Bake in the preheated oven for 8-10 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den. The centers may look slightly underbaked; they will firm up as they cool.
- Cool Cookies: Remove the cookies from the oven and allow them to cool on the baking sheet for about 5 minutes, then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Decorate: Once cooled, you can decorate your sugar cookies with icing made from powdered sugar and milk, adding food coloring if desired.
Enjoy your Classic Motor City Sugar Cookies as they bring holiday joy to your gatherings!

Detroit-Style Peppermint Bark Cookies

Detroit-Style Peppermint Bark Cookies are a festive twist on the classic cookie, combining rich chocolate and invigorating peppermint flavors. These cookies have a chewy texture and are topped with a decadent layer of chocolate and crushed peppermint candy, making them a perfect holiday treat for cookie lovers and party guests alike. They are sure to bring a touch of Detroit cheer to any holiday gathering!
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Unsweetened cocoa powder | ½ cup |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ter | 1 cup (softened) |
| Granulated sugar | 1 cup |
| Brown sugar | ½ cup (packed) |
| Egg |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Semi-sweet chocolate chips | 1 cup |
| Crushed peppermint candies | ½ cup |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t until thoroughly combined. Set this mixture a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large bowl, use a hand mixer or stand mixer to cream the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ar together. Mix on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, which should take about 2-3 minutes.
- Add Egg and Vanilla: Beat in the egg and vanilla extract into the butter-sugar mixture until smooth and fully incorporated.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et mixture. Start mixing on low speed to blend, then increase to medium speed until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.
- Fold in Chocolate Chips: Gently fold the semi-sweet chocolate chips into the cookie dough until evenly distributed.
- Scoop Dough onto Baking Sheet: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for 10-12 minutes. The cookies should look set around the edges but may appear slightly soft in the center.
- Prepare Peppermint Topping: While the cookies are baking, melt an additional ½ cup of semi-sweet chocolate chips in a microwave-safe bowl in 20-second intervals, stirring until smooth.
- Add Peppermint Topping: Once the cookies are out of the oven and slightly cooled (about 5 minutes), drizzle the melted chocolate over each cookie. Sprinkle the crushed peppermint candies evenly on top while the chocolate is still warm, allowing them to stick.
- Cool the Cookies: Allow the cookies to cool completely on a wire rack. The chocolate topping will harden as they cool, creating a delightful finishing touch.
- Serve and Enjoy: Once cooled, serve the Detroit-Style Peppermint Bark Cookies as a sweet festive treat or package them as gifts for friends and family during the holiday season!

Automobile Gingerbread Men

Automobile Gingerbread Men are a fun and festive twist on traditional gingerbread cookies, perfect for the holiday season, especially in a city known for its automotive legacy like Detroit. These delightful cookies are shaped like cars and decorated with colorful icing, making them a hit for both kids and adults. They not only taste amazing with their warm spices and molasses flavor but also adds a creative touch to your holiday baking!
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 3 cups |
| Ground ginger | 2 teaspoons |
| Ground cinnamon | 2 teaspoons |
| Ground nutmeg | ½ teaspoon |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ter | ¾ cup (softened) |
| Brown sugar | 1 cup (packed) |
| Molasses | ½ cup |
| Egg |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, ground ginger, ground cinnamon, ground nutmeg, baking soda, and salt until well combined. Set this mixture a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ugar: In another large bowl, use a hand mixer or stand mixer to cream the softened butter and brown sugar together. Mix on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-5 minutes.
- Add Molasses, Egg, and Vanilla: Beat in the molasses, egg, and vanilla extract into the butter mixture until smooth and fully incorporated.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et mixture. Start mixing on low speed to integrate, then increase to medium speed until the dough comes together. The dough will be thick.
- Chill the Dough: Divide the dough in half, wrap each portion in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es. This step helps the dough firm up, making it easier to roll out.
- Roll Out Dough: On a lightly floured surface, take one half of the chilled dough and roll it out to about ¼ inch thick. Use a cookie cutter shaped like a car to cut out the cookies.
- Transfer to Baking Sheet: Carefully transfer the cut-out gingerbread men cars onto the prepared baking sheets, spacing them about 1-2 inches apart.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ake for 8-10 minutes, until the edges are firm but the centers are still soft. They will harden as they cool.
- Cool the Cookies: Remove the baking sheets from the oven and allow the cookies to cool on the sheets for a few min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Decorate the Cookies: Once the cookies are cool, use royal icing or your favorite frosting to decorate the gingerbread cars as desired with colorful accents and details.
- Enjoy: Serve these delightful Automobile Gingerbread Men at your holiday gatherings, or package them as gifts for friends and family. Enjoy the sweet holiday cheer they bring!

Motor City Oatmeal Raisin Cookies

Motor City Oatmeal Raisin Cookies are a classic holiday treat that embodies the warmth and comfort of homemade baking. These chewy cookies are packed with hearty oats and sweet raisins, offering a wholesome and satisfying bite. They’re perfect for sharing with family and friends or enjoying with a cozy cup of tea or coffee during the bustling holiday season in Detroit.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 1 cup |
| Old-fashioned rolled oats | 2 cups |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Ground cinnamon |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ter | ½ cup (softened) |
| Brown sugar | 1 cup (packed) |
| Granulated sugar |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 2 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Raisins | 1 cup |
| Chopped nuts (optional) | 1 cup |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Prepare two baking sheets by lining them with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, baking soda, ground cinnamon, and salt. Whisk these ingredients together until they are evenly mixed and set a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large bowl, use a hand mixer or stand mixer to cream together the softened unsalted but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ar. Mix on medium-high spe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Eggs and Vanilla: Beat the eggs into the creamed butter and sugar mixture one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ract. Mix until fully combined.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Slowly add the flour mixture to the wet ingredients, mixing on low speed until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.
- Incorporate Oats and Raisins: Gently fold in the rolled oats, raisins, and chopped nuts (if using) with a spatula until evenly distributed throughout the dough.
- Scoop the Dough: Using a tablespoon or a c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, spacing them about 2 inches apart to allow for spreading.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own. The centers may look slightly underbaked but will firm up as they cool.
- Cool the Cookies: Remove the baking sheets from the oven and let the cookies cool on the sheets for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Enjoy your freshly baked Motor City Oatmeal Raisin Cookies, a delightful addition to any holiday gathering!

Cherry-Infused Pistachio Surprise Cookies

Cherry-Infused Pistachio Surprise Cookies are a delightful holiday treat that combines the sweetness of cherries with the rich, nutty flavor of pistachios. These cookies offer a surprising burst of flavor with every bite, making them a unique addition to your holiday cookie platter. Perfect for sharing with loved ones or enjoying alongside a cup of warm cocoa, these vibrant cookies are sure to impress during the festive season!
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 1 ½ cups |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ter | ¾ cup (softened) |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Brown sugar | ½ cup (packed) |
| Eggs |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Dried cherries | 1 cup (chopped) |
| Chopped pistachios | ½ cup |
| White chocolate chips | ½ cup |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per for easy clean-up.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t. Set this mixture a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large bowl, use an electric mixer to cream the softened unsalted butter with granulated sugar and brown sugar. Beat the mixture on medium speed until it becomes light and fluffy, which should take about 4-5 minutes.
- Add Egg and Vanilla: Add the egg and vanilla extract to the creamed mixture, mixing until fully incorporated.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the flour mixture into the wet ingredients, mixing on low speed just until combined. Be careful not to overmix the dough.
- Fold in Cherry and Pistachios: Gently fold in the chopped dried cherries, chopped pistachios, and white chocolate chips using a spatula,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the dough.
- Scoop the Dough: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ches of space between each cookie for spreading.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ges start to turn golden brown. The centers may look slightly underbaked; this is okay as they will firm up while cooling.
- Cool the Cookies: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heets for about 5 minutes before transferring them to wire racks to cool completely. Enjoy your Cherry-Infused Pistachio Surprise Cookies!

Mocha Espresso Chocolate Chip Cookies

Mocha Espresso Chocolate Chip Cookies are a decadent treat that combines the rich flavors of espresso and chocolate in a chewy, soft cookie. Perfect for coffee lovers, these cookies deliver a delightful caffeine kick along with the sweetness of chocolate chips, making them ideal for enjoying with a warm beverage or sharing during the holiday season.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| ¾ cup |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Brown sugar (packed) |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 2 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Instant espresso powder | 2 tablespoons |
| Semi-sweet chocolate chips | 1 cup |
| Chopped walnuts (optional) | ½ cup |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, salt, and instant espresso powder. Set this flour mixture aside for later use.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to cream the softened un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ar together on medium speed until light and fluffy, which should take about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Eggs and Vanilla: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ition, followed by the vanilla extract. Make sure everything is well combined.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the flour mixture to the creamed sugar m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. Avoid overmixing the dough at this stage.
- Fold in Chocolate Chips and Walnuts: Using a spatula, gently f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ips and chopped walnuts (if using) until evenly distributed throughout the cookie dough.
- Scoop the Dough: Use a tablespoon or cookie scoop to drop rounded balls of the c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ches of space between each cookie for spreading.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heets in the preheated oven and b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own and the centers are set but still soft.
- Cool and Enjoy: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your Mocha Espresso Chocolate Chip Cookies with a glass of milk or your favorite coffee!

Spiced Cranberry Walnut Cookies

Spiced Cranberry Walnut Cookies are a festive treat that brings a delightful combination of tart cranberries, crunchy walnuts, and warm spices together in one delicious cookie. Perfect for holiday gatherings or as a thoughtful gift, these cookies not only taste great but also fill your kitchen with a comforting aroma.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Ground cinnamon | 1 teaspoon |
| Ground ginger | ½ te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| ¾ cup |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Brown sugar (packed) |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Dried cranberries | 1 cup |
| Chopped walnuts | ½ cup |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Prepare two baking sheets by lining them with parchment paper to prevent the cookies from s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, baking soda, ground cinnamon, ground ginger, and salt. Stir everything together until well mixed, and set aside.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to cream the softened un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ar together on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, approximately 3-4 minutes.
- Add Egg and Vanilla: Beat in the egg and vanilla extract into the creamed mixture, mixing until everything is well incorporated.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the prepared d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. Be cautious not to overmix the dough.
- Fold in Cranberries and Walnuts: Using a spatula, gently fold in the dried cranberries and chopped walnuts,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the dough.
- Scoop the Dough: With a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op rounded balls of c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ches of space between each cookie to allow for spreading during baking.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the baking sheets into the preheated oven and b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den and the centers are set.
- Cool the Cookies: Once baked, remove the cookies from the oven and allow them to cool on the baking sheets for about 5 min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Enjoy your flavorful Spiced Cranberry Walnut Cookies, perfect for sharing during the holiday season!

Nutty Caramel Pecan Delights

Nutty Caramel Pecan Delights are a rich and indulgent cookie that combines the delectable flavors of toasted pecans with a luscious caramel filling. These cookies are perfect for the holiday season, showcasing a beautiful balance of nutty crunch and sweet gooeyness that will delight family and friends alike.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| ¾ cup |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Brown sugar (packed) |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 1 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Chopped pecans | 1 cup |
| Caramel candies (chopped) | 1 cup |
| Milk (for melting caramel) | 2 tablespoons |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per for easy cookie removal.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t. This will guarantee that the leavening agent is evenly distributed throughout the dough.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to cream the softened un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ar together on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Egg and Vanilla: Add the egg and vanilla extract to the creamed butter and sugars. Mix until fully combined.
- Incorporate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can lead to tough cookies.
- Fold in Pecans: Gently fold in the chopped pecans,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the dough.
- Prepare Caramel: In a small saucepan, combine the chopped caramel candies and milk over low heat. Stir continuously until the caramel is melted and smooth. Remove from heat and let it cool slightly.
- Scoop the Dough: Use a tablespoon or cookie scoop to drop rounded balls of c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ving ample space (about 2 inches) between each cookie.
- Add Caramel to Cookies: Make an indentation in the center of each cookie ball using your thumb or the back of a spoon. Spoon a small amount of the melted caramel into the center of each indentation.
- Bake the Cookies: Bake the cookies in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are lightly golden and the centers are set.
- Cool the Cookies: Once baked, remove the cookies from the oven and let them cool on the baking sheets for about 5 minutes. Then, transfer them to wire racks to cool completely.
Enjoy your Nutty Caramel Pecan Delights during the festive season!

Red Velvet Holiday Whoopie Pies

Red Velvet Holiday Whoopie Pies are decadent and festive treats that bring a delightful twist to traditional holiday baking. These charming sandwich cookies feature soft, red velvet cake-like cookies filled with a creamy frosting. The vibrant color and rich flavors make them an attractive addition to any holiday dessert table, perfect for sharing with family and friends.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Unsweetened cocoa powder | 1 tablespoon |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| ½ cup |
| Granulated sugar | 1 cup |
| Brown sugar (packed) |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 2 large |
| Red food coloring | 2 tablespoons |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Buttermilk | 1 cup |
| Cream cheese (softened) | 4 oz |
| Powdered sugar | 2 cups |
| Vanilla extract (for frosting) | 1 teaspoon |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per to prevent the whoopie pies from s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. This will help to aerate the flour and guarantee an even distribution of dry ingredients.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ar using an electric mixer on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Eggs and Food Coloring: Add the eggs one at a time to the butter and sugar mixture, mixing well after each addition. Then, add the red food coloring and vanilla extract, mixing until the color is evenly distributed.
- Incorporate Buttermilk: Gradually add the buttermilk to the wet mixture, combining until fully blended. The mixture should be smooth and well-incorporated.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Slowly add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et mixture and mix on low speed until just combined. Be careful not to overmix to maintain a light texture.
- Drop Dough onto Baking Sheet: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ving about 2 inches of space between each one.
- Bake the Cookies: Bake the whoopie pie cookies in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Remove from the oven and let them c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Prepare Frosting: In a medium b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ar and vanilla extract, mixing until you have a fluffy frosting.
- Assemble Whoopie Pies: Once the cookies have cooled completely, flip half of them upside down. Spread a generous dollop of cream cheese frosting on the flat side of each of the flipped cookies and then top them with another cookie, pressing down gently to create a sandwich.
- Serve and Enjoy: Your Red Velvet Holiday Whoopie Pies are now ready to be enjoyed! Store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ep them fresh.

Orange Zest Linzer Cookies

|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Almond flour | 1 cup |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| 1 cup |
| Orange zest | 1 tablespoon |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Baking powder | ½ teaspoon |
| Salt | ¼ teaspoon |
| Egg yolk | 1 large |
| Fruit preserves (raspberry, apricot, etc.) | ½ cup |
| Powdered sugar (for dusting) | Optional |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per to guarantee the cookies bake evenly and do not stick.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, almond flour, baking powder, and salt. Set this dry mixture aside for later use.
- Cream Butter and Sugar: In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ened unsalted butter and granulated sugar using an electric mixer on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Flavorings: Add the orange zest and vanilla extract to the butter and sugar mixture. Continue to beat until fully incorporated, making sure the zest is evenly distributed.
- Incorporate Egg Yolk: Add the egg yolk to the buttery mixture and mix until combined. This will help bind the dough together.
-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ients: Gradually add the dry ingredient mixture to the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. Do not overmix, as this can toughen the cookies.
- Chill the Dough: Wrap the d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ate for about 30 minutes. Chilling the dough will make it easier to roll out.
- Roll Out the Dough: Once chilled, remove the dough from the refrigerator and place it on a lightly floured surface. Roll it out to about ¼-inch thickness.
- Cut Out Cookies: Using a cookie cutter, cut out shapes from the rolled dough. For half of the cookies, use a smaller cookie cutter to cut out a shape in the center, creating a window for the filling.
- Bake the Cookies: Place the cut-out cookies on the prepared baking sheets and b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den.
- Cool the Cookies: Remove the cookies from the oven and let them c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
- Assemble the Cookies: Once the cookies are fully cooled, spread a generous amount of fruit preserves on the solid cookie halves. Place the cut-out cookies on top to create a sandwich.
- Dust with Powdered Sugar: If desired, dust the tops of the sandwich cookies with powdered sugar for a festive touch before serving.
Enjoy your delectable Orange Zest Linzer Cookies with a cup of tea or coffee during the holiday season!
S’mores Inspired Motor City Treats

S’mores Inspired Motor City Treats are a delightful fusion of the classic campfire treat with a Detroit twist. These bars combine the rich flavors of chocolate, graham crackers, and marshmallows, all encased in a delicious cookie base to create a perfect sweet treat that captures the spirit of the holiday season.
| Ingredients | Quantity |
|---|---|
| All-purpose flour | 2 cups |
| Graham cracker crumbs | 1 cup |
| Granulated sugar | ¾ cup |
| Brown sugar | ¼ cup |
| Unsalted butter (softened) | ½ cup |
| Eggs | 2 large |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on |
| Baking soda | 1 teaspoon |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on |
| Semi-sweet chocolate chips | 1 cup |
| Mini marshmallows | 1 cup |
| Extra graham cracker crumbs | for topping |
Cooking Steps:
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×13 in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
- Prepare the Cookie Dough: In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y. This should take about 2-3 minutes.
- Add Eggs and Vanilla: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Then add the vanilla extract and continue mixing until fully incorporated.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, graham cracker crumbs, baking soda, and salt.
- Combine Mixtures: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Do not overmix the dough; a few lumps are fine.
- Fold in Chocolate and Marshmallows: Gently f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ips and mini marshmallows until evenly distributed in the cookie dough.
- Spread the Dough: Pour the dough into the prepared baking pan, spreading it evenly with a spatula. Sprinkle extra graham cracker crumbs on top for added texture and flavor.
- Bake the Treats: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for about 22-25 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den and the center is set. The marshmallows should also be slightly toasted.
- Cool and Slice: Once baked, remove the pan from the oven and let it cool completely in the pan on a wire rack. Once cooled, slice into squares or bars.
- Serve and Enjoy: Serve your S’mores Inspired Motor City Treats as a festive holiday treat or dessert, and enjoy the delightful flavors of a classic S’mores experience!
